Output 1088c15bb06af12e95ce8527c65faf66a48d1add21fd425f2ad68fa3e089f250:2

value
51471356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090d6b9e9ec15d0108bb766a66bbbf35bc9fda19 OP_EQUAL
address
32Wt5jbVs1WJrsVHVtbwPpsZMaS32McL7e
transaction
1088c15bb06af12e95ce8527c65faf66a48d1add21fd425f2ad68fa3e089f250
spent
true